Eagle : Eagle is an electronic design automation (EDA) software used for printed circuit board (PCB) design. It allows schematic capture and laying out of PCBs. Eagle has a free version for non-commercial use, and paid versions with more features.

Eagle
Eagle Features
  • Schematic capture
  • PCB layout
  • Autorouting
  • Design rule checking
  • 3D visualization
  • Library editor
  • Import/export various file formats

Eagle
Eagle

Pros

  • Free version available
  • Easy to use interface
  • Large component library
  • Good for hobbyists and small projects

Cons

  • Limited capabilities in free version
  • Steep learning curve
  • Not suitable for large, complex designs
  • Only 2 signal layers in free version
